Summary
Join Axon and contribute to our mission of protecting life. As an engineering team member, you will play a crucial role in designing and developing our newest products, a platform providing law enforcement with flexible access to crime data and investigative insights. You will participate in code reviews, own end-to-end features, ensure high-quality code, and collaborate with internal and external teams. This position offers remote work flexibility near various US R&D hubs, allowing for in-person collaboration when needed. Axon provides a competitive salary, comprehensive benefits, and opportunities for professional growth.
Requirements
- Bachelor's Degree in Computer Science or Engineering, OR graduate of coding boot camp OR 3+ years of relevant experience in related field
- Highly technical with experience developing and maintaining end-to-end, high availability, high throughput web-scale data systems
- Backend experience in managed languages such as Java, Scala, Go, C#, or similar
- Demonstrated ability to make tough technical decisions based on requirements, constraints, and trade-offs
- You follow the latest in software engineering and open source technologies
Responsibilities
- Participate in code reviews and architecture design meetings
- Own and drive end-to-end features with Product and Design
- Ensure that your code hits a high bar for quality and performance
- Partner with internal teams and agencies to make public safety data accessible and actionable
- Influence peers, advise senior leaders, coach and mentor junior team members
- Facilitate cross-team collaboration among engineers and contribute to the broader community of Axon engineers
Preferred Qualifications
- Industry experience working with SQL or NoSQL data stores is a plus
- Good Linux/Unix/Mac experience is a plus
- You love delighting end users and hunger for novel challenges
Benefits
- Competitive salary and 401k with employer match
- Discretionary paid time off
- Paid parental leave for all
- Medical, Dental, Vision plans
- Fitness Programs
- Emotional & Mental Wellness support
- Learning & Development programs
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.